2. Common Interview Questions

The following questions reflect patterns observed in recent interviews. While specific technical challenges vary by team, you should prepare for a rigorous assessment of your fundamental coding ability, deep learning expertise, and the ability to articulate your research history.

Technical Coding & Algorithms

These questions assess your ability to implement efficient solutions under pressure, often focusing on core data structures and algorithmic efficiency.

  • Implement a 5-node MLP backpropagation in NumPy.
  • Solve a medium-difficulty LeetCode dynamic programming problem.

3. Getting Ready for Your Interviews

Success at ByteDance/Tiktok requires a balance of theoretical mastery and practical coding speed. You should approach your preparation by focusing on the "how" and "why" behind your research, while maintaining a sharp edge on your algorithmic implementation skills.

Technical Proficiency – Interviewers expect you to be comfortable implementing core ML components from scratch, such as backpropagation or custom loss functions using libraries like NumPy or PyTorch. Mastery of these tools is a baseline expectation, not an optional skill.

Research Communication – You must be able to articulate your past research clearly and concisely. Be prepared to defend your methodological choices and explain how your work addresses specific limitations in the field.

System Design Thinking – For more senior or product-focused roles, you will be evaluated on your ability to design end-to-end systems. Focus on how you would bridge the gap between a research model and a production-ready feature, considering latency, scalability, and data constraints.

4. Interview Process Overview

The interview process at ByteDance/Tiktok is known for being highly efficient and technical, typically consisting of 3 to 4 rounds. The process usually begins with an HR screening to establish your background and interest, followed by a series of technical deep-dives and coding assessments. You will interact with both hiring managers and technical peers, who will evaluate your ability to contribute to their specific research agenda.

The pace is generally fast, with rounds often scheduled closely together. You should expect a direct, no-nonsense approach to interviewing where the focus remains strictly on your technical output and research potential. Because the process is highly modular, ensure you are prepared for a variety of topics, as different interviewers may focus on entirely distinct domains of expertise.

7. Role Requirements & Qualifications

A strong candidate for this position brings a combination of academic rigor and hands-on technical experience.

  • Technical Skills – Extensive experience with deep learning, computer vision, or audio processing; strong proficiency in Python and C++; mastery of PyTorch or TensorFlow.

  • Experience Level – A PhD or equivalent research experience is typically expected, with a track record of publications in top-tier conferences.

  • Soft Skills – Ability to communicate complex ideas to non-research stakeholders and a collaborative mindset for working across engineering and product teams.

  • Must-have – Strong publication record and advanced implementation skills.

  • Nice-to-have – Experience with large-scale distributed training and model deployment.

9. Other General Tips

  • Structure your answers – Use the STAR method (Situation, Task, Action, Result) for behavioral questions, even if they are infrequent.
  • Know your own work – Be prepared to answer extremely granular questions about every line of code or logic in your published research.
  • Practice live coding – Don't just study algorithms; practice writing them in an editor without an IDE to simulate the interview environment.
  • Be ready for "Randomness" – Because the process can vary by team, have a broad review of your entire technical toolkit rather than over-indexing on one area.
